Glen Allen, Virginia AA Meetings
Glen Allen is a census-designated place in Eastern Virginia’s Henrico County, United States. Alcoholics Anonymous is a global organization providing solutions to alcohol addictions and substance use disorders among people. This community has helped millions of people out of addiction-related challenges and is still very functional. Glen Allen community has had its taste of alcohol addictions, and it is one that is very painful to recount. Fortunately, AA meetings in Glen Allen have been structured by the AA Virginia community to reach out directly to affected persons and help them attain sobriety from alcohol. These meetings employ the 12-step approach to addictions as a manual guide for participants, which has helped many of them achieve stability.
